CITATION : Regina v Georgiou & Harrison [2000] NSWSC 287 FILE NUMBER(S) : SC 70069/98; 70038/98 HEARING DATE(S) : 22/08/99-02/99 JUDGMENT DATE : 10 March 2000
Regina PARTIES : Constantine Georgiou Bruce Malcolm Harrison JUDGMENT OF : Dowd J at 1
Mr Bill Dawe S.C.: Crown COUNSEL : Mr Gabriel Wendler: Georgiou Mr Robert Somosi: Harrison S.E. O'Connor SOLICITORS : Xenos Jordan Solicitors Michael Croke & Co CATCHWORDS : sentence - murder - attempted murder - totality Crimes Act 1900 LEGISLATION CITED : Sentencing Act 1989 Victims Rights Act 1996 Regina v Previtera (1997) 94 A Crim R 67 Regina v Issacs (1997) 90 A Crim R 587 Regina v Veen [No.2] 164 CLR 465 Ibbs v The Queen (1987) 163 CLR 447 Regina v Twala (unreported, NSWCCA, 4 November 1994) Regina v Garforth (unreported, NSW CCA 23 May 1994) CASES CITED : Regina v Leonard (unreported, NSW CCA 7 December 1998) Regina v Fernando (unreported, NSW SC 21 August 1997) Regina v Kalajzich 94 A Crim R 41 Regina v Petroff (unreported, NSW CCA 12 November 1991) Mill v The Queen (1988) 166 CLR 372 Regina v Postiglione (1997) 71 ALJR 475 R v Pearce (1998) 156 ALR 684 DECISION : Each convicted of three counts of murder and one count of attempted murder; Sentenced concurrently on each count of murder and attempted murder
